What are some common types of lifting hooks?

  As the main tool for material lifting, the emergence of cranes has played a good role in lifting and handling heavy objects in people's operations. For cranes, hooks are one of the very important components. For example, if a crane wants to carry heavy objects, it must have a hook to cooperate.

  According to the current development situation in the market, there are many common types of hooks, but they are each suitable for different cranes.

  If divided according to shape, the hooks of the crane can be divided into single hooks and double grooves. In contrast, single hooks are easy to manufacture and use and are used to lift objects with relatively light weight; while the double grooves weigh more and are generally used to lift objects with larger weights.

  If it is distinguished from the perspective of manufacturing methods, the crane hook can be divided into forged hooks and sheet hooks. The former is mainly used for lifting cranes with lifting capacity below 30T, while the latter is used for lifting cranes with lifting capacity of 75T-350T. In addition, the crane hook can also be distinguished from the cross-sectional shape of the hook body, including round, square, trapezoidal and T-shaped.

  Analyzing based on the stress conditions, the T-shaped cross-section design is more reasonable, but the forging process of this type of crane hook is also relatively complicated; in comparison, the trapezoidal cross-section is more reasonable and forging is easy; while the rectangular cross-section is only used for sheet hooks, and the load-bearing capacity of the cross-section is not fully utilized; the circular cross-section is only used for small hooks.
